 Iraq's central government has not reached a deal with the Kurdistan Regional Government to recognize contracts the Kurds signed with foreign oil companies . "The Iraqi Oil Ministry considers the contracts signed by the KRG as illegal and void," a senior Iraqi Oil Ministry official said on Wednesday. Unconfirmed reports of such a deal had caused share prices in Norwegian oil firm DNO to soar. The official said the Kurdish contracts remained the main stumbling block to agreeing a draft national oil law that will open up the country's energy sector to foreign investment.

 The terrorist state of Turkey sentenced 53 Kurdish mayors to more than two months in prison. The mayors had been on trial since September 2006 over a letter they wrote to Danish Prime Minister Anders Rasmussen in December 2005, asking him to ignore Turkish military's calls to ban the Denmark-based Kurdish television station Roj TV, reported AP today

The terrorist state of Turkey sentenced Kurdish politician Leyla Zana to two years' imprisonment for praising the Kurdish leader Abdullah Ocalan. The charges stem from a speech she made in March 2007 at a Kurdish festival, counting Ocalan among Kurdish national leaders along with Jalal Talabani and Maossud Barzani. "I am grateful to those three leaders... They all have a place in the hearts and minds of the Kurds," said the former Nobel peace prize nominee, zana.
